This is Kat, one of Lendon's working students and a lovely rider and model. She rode three different horses for us while Lendon talked about dressage.
We were able to shoot in a big field at Gleneden with big beautiful trees and not a bad background anywhere, and they kept bringing out more beautiful horses and riders, it was pretty unreal actually now that I think back on it!

These pots caught my eye as I arrived at Pinnacle first thing in the morning. We had a discussion the day before about how much easier it s for artists to "see" things when they are shooting photos. I have always struggled with this as I cannot even draw stick figures let alone anything else!
BUT, when I drove by this little building, these pots jumped right out at me. I love how the shadows from the trees fall on the building. I did not leave a lot on the bottom and I wish I had, There was a shadow in the grass that bothered me so I did not include it.

I was amazed at the amount of time that Lendon gave us out of her hectic schedule. She had riders demonstrating every move in dressage, explaining the footfall of each and when the best capture point is for each movement. Piaffe anyone!
